Handover: Restocker planner (for plugin folks)

Hi all — I'm passing Restocker maintenance to Vela before I rotate off. Quick notes for plugin authors: the planner recalculates routes nightly, and your plugins get called during the demand-forecast phase, not after. If your hook is slow, the whole machine fleet plan slips. Keep handlers under 200ms and idempotent, since retries are aggressive. Plugins run inside the planner sandbox, which boots with the following configuration values.

settings of kahap-kahof:
[aldvan]
port = 6379
team = istox
host = aldvan.plorvalabs.internal
region = west-1
access_code = ac_e12344
timeout_ms = 2000

CI NOTE — Replica Lag Alarm (Brindlewick cluster)

On-call: the read-replica lag alarm fires during the nightly compaction window because the threshold was set below normal catch-up time. This is expected noise, not data loss. The alarm config was retuned to a five-minute sustained threshold and deployed via the Larkmoor pipeline. If it still pages outside the compaction window, escalate to the storage rotation. Confirm the deployed config matches the build noted here:

trace token, kawip-fafog: htk14_26e64c4d35154e

Subject: ChipGate reader cut-over — summary

Hi Tovan,

Welcome aboard. Last night we cut the Fenwick Marathon timing-chip readers over to the new SplitStream ingestion pipeline. All forty mats reported cleanly, duplicate reads dropped below 0.3%, and the legacy collector is now decommissioned. Please review the reconciliation job before Saturday's trial event. The reader fleet is currently running with the following configuration values.

config for kajog-tadug:
[casax]
port = 11211
region = west-3
host = casax.nelvroworks.internal
timeout_ms = 5000
retries = 7